OK, I FINALLY after all these years spoke to Galina on the phone. She calls
me "Dahlink". I love it <<<grin>>>>.
The lights in Odessa go on and off. They have no electricity at night and
she uses candles. I guess that pretty much kills storing food in the
fridge. The lights in the Archives go on and off. They cannot carry candles
for obvious concerns about fire. She says their 'lanterns' are very bad (I
will assume the 'lanterns' are flashlights).
